    Car things: as a 26 year old, i find the things i need most of all are jump leads (and the knowledge of how to use them), a first aid kit (imagine seeing an accident where someone is hurt and you can't do anything to help them - if you have a first aid kit you may save their life), and a road atlas - don't keep it in the boot either! When you are lost and annoyed at being lost, the last thing you want to do is stop the car and go look in the boot!

    Ia first aid kit (imagine seeing an accident where someone is hurt and you can't do anything to help them - if you have a first aid kit you may save their life),
    To be fair, most first aid kits don't have life-saving equipment in them (generally dressings, plasters etc) and those that do require a knowledge of first aid and the techniques you should use otherwise you risk making things worse. If you DO see an accident and are first on the scene, the best thing you can do is to call 999 and follow any instructions they give you. Even doctors and paramedics sometimes need the fire service in attendance (kazm is probably aware of the instructions that were given out to those attending emergencies during the last fire brigate strike, and they weren't pleasant) in order to be able to provide medical assistance.

    So maybe a car charger for a mobile phone would be a good idea?
